CAVIPHY develops a device that uses cavitation to enhance the treatment of waste activated sludge from wastewater treatment plants. By improving the breakdown and processing of this sludge, the project aims to reduce costs and environmental impact while generating renewable bioenergy from methane.
One of the most pressing global problems is the increasing pollution of surface and groundwater, which threatens the world's clean water supply and public health.
Wastewater treatment plants (WWTPs), the last barrier between ever-increasing human activities and the environment, produce huge amounts, up to 13 million tonnes per year in the EU alone1, of unwanted semi-solid by-product - waste activated sludge (WAS).
